What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ps create or optimize use case pages that clearly connect product capabilities to specific customer scenarios and problems, driving better user understanding and conversion.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Scenario-First Organization: Structures content around concrete situations and user needs.
  • Content Differentiation: Ensures use case pages complement, rather than duplicate, feature and solution pages.
  • SEO Optimization: Tailors content for commercial intent and specific user queries.
  • Use Case: Generate a use case page for a SaaS product targeting "event marketers" to explain how the platform helps them "run event marketing at scale."

What is the difference between a use case page and a feature page for B2B content strategy?

Use case pages focus on "when would I use it?" by organizing content around concrete customer scenarios and personas, differentiating them from feature pages that list capabilities and solution pages that target broader categories.

When should I avoid generating a use case page and use a solution page instead?

Avoid use case pages when your content strategy requires targeting broader solution categories rather than specific scenarios, as use case pages are designed to answer specific "when would I use it?" questions for distinct personas.
